Bellinger" Cc: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org, target-devel , Joern Engel Subject: [PATCH 2/3] target: remove unused codes from enum tcm_tmrsp_table Date: Wed, 3 Jul 2013 11:22:16 -0400 Message-Id: <1372864937-32437-3-git-send-email-joern@logfs.org> X-Mailer: git-send-email 1.7.2.5 In-Reply-To: <1372864937-32437-1-git-send-email-joern@logfs.org> References: <1372864937-32437-1-git-send-email-joern@logfs.org> Sender: linux-kernel-owner@vger.kernel.org List-ID: X-Mailing-List: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org Content-Length: 2708 Lines: 73 Three have been checked for but were never set. Remove the dead code. Also renumbers the remaining ones to a) get rid of the holes after the removal and b) avoid a collision between TMR_FUNCTION_COMPLETE==0 and the uninitialized case. If we failed to set a code, we should rather fall into the default case then return success.
